The Amazing Bright Orange Squirrel!

The bright orange squirrel is a fun little animal you might see in parks or forests. These squirrels are special for many reasons, but one of the coolest things they can do is jump! Let's break down how they can jump from branch to branch.

1. Strong Legs

First, squirrels have strong back legs. Just like how you might run and jump high during playtime, squirrels use their powerful legs to push off the branches. This helps them leap to a spot that is far away.

2. Sharp Claws

Next, squirrels have sharp claws on their feet. These claws grab onto the tree bark, which helps to keep them steady and secure as they jump. So, even if they land on a thin branch, their claws help them hang on tight!

3. Good Balance

Another important skill they have is balance. Squirrels are super good at balancing their bodies while jumping. Just like when you ride a bicycle or a skateboard—you need to keep your balance to not fall off!

4. Aiming Skills

Lastly, bright orange squirrels can aim really well. They will look at the branch they want to land on, just like how you might look at where you want to jump or throw a ball. This way, they can safely reach their destination without missing!

So, when you see a bright orange squirrel jumping from tree to tree, remember the strong legs, sharp claws, good balance, and aiming skills that help them do such amazing leaps!
